NEW Battery Recycling Regulations - Feb 2010
New regulations have been introduced to enable easier recyling of household batteries, which includes cell batteries and rechargeable batteries.  All stores that sell over 32kg of batteries per year must now offer a recycling point in store.  More information is available on the NetRegs website.

Food Labelling and Carbon Footprints - Jan 2010
72% of people polled in a supermarkets survey would like to see the Carbon Footprint of the product clearly identified on the label.  This will encourage them to make greener choices.  The survey results come hot on the heels of the government's publication of their Food 2030 strategy on 7th January.  More on this article on the Packaging News website.

TetraPak Go FSC!
Here's some great news - TetraPak have announced plans to use FSC certified materials on 75% of their cartons in the UK and Ireland.  This will equate to a whopping 1.5bn packs!

FSC Friday - 25th September 2009
25th September sees the first international day of recognition for FSC, designed to promote global awareness of sustainable forest management and the products that are covered by the FSC certification.  There are lots of events in the UK celebrating and promoting the success of FSC - why not click on the link in the logo to see if there are any events in your neck of the woods (excuse the pun!).
